The heat contents of solid and liquid rich-Te Ag-Te and Cu-Te eutectic
s from 298 K to T (421< T< 820 K and 512 < T < 800 K respectively) wer
e measured on heating (drop method) with the help of a high temperatur
e Tian-Calvet calorimeter. The heat capacity of both liquid and solid
eutectics as well as their enthalpies of fusion were deduced. The ther
modynamic behaviour of the two eutectics in the liquid state appear ve
ry simple. Their strong short-range orders can be explained by one kin
d of associate the stoichiometry of which corresponds to the single co
ngruently melting compound of the systems, i.e. Ag2Te and Cu2Te respec
tively. Then, the two eutectics investigated can be considered as refe
rence systems for our further works on weakly associated alloys.
